Two boys found drowned in Sungai Triang


KUANTAN: The bodies of two friends who went missing after being swept away by strong currents in Sungai Triang near Bera's Kerayong chicken market on Tuesday (Aug 16) have been found.

Pahang Fire and Rescue Department assistant director of operations Ismail Abdul Ghani said the body of Muhammad Nik Iqmal Shah Ismail, 15, was found at 10.30pm on Wednesday (Aug 17), about 400m from where he went missing.

He added that the body of Muhammad Danial Irsyad Norazlan, 11, was found by members of the public at 1.30am on Thursday (Aug 18), also about 400m from where he was last seen.

The bodies were handed over to the police for further action.

The victims were swimming in the river with several other friends when the current swept them away at about 3.30pm on Tuesday. – Bernama
